Teknik Komposisi Motif Digital Dengan Inspirasi Paksi Naga Liman Untuk Produk Tekstil

Abstract

Abstract The development of digital pattern processing techniques is influenced by the emergence of pattern pro- cessing softwares, which on of them is JBatik with the characteristics of overlapping and repetitive patterns formed from the use of fractal formulas, so that it has the potential as a processing media for the composition of patterns combined with other pattern processing software in creating pattern modules. This study aims to combine the potential of the advantages and disadvantages of each digital software to efficiently compose new patterns inspired by Paksi Naga Liman. The data search method used is qualitative and quantitative methods in the form of literature studies, interviews, observations, and conducting experiments. The results obtained from this study are the incorporation of the potential of the motive visualiza- tion character from CorelDraw vector-based software to process pattern variations and the potential use of fractal formula features on JBatik to create new pattern compositions making the processing of patterns to be efficient with easy pro- cessing. Getting inspiration from one of Indonesia's unique classic ornaments, Paksi Naga Liman, it is expected to be able to make a variety of new patterns with different visualization characters and compositions to be applied to textile products.

Keywords Digital Pattern Composition, Digital Pattern Processing Software, Paksi Naga Liman
